During the entire week, gcc 3.1 mips-sgi-irix6.5 failed because of
mabi=64 libstdc++ problems.  gcc 3.1 i686-pc-linux-gnu fails because
libgcj.so references `__rethrow@GCC_3.0' and other undefined
?misnamed? exception handling routines.

A sequence of daily failures for gcc 3.0 ended for both
i686-pc-linux-gnu and mips-sgi-irix6.5, but over 800 mips-sgi-irix6.5
C++ tests fail for an unknown reason.  gcc 3.0 i686-pc-linux-gnu is in
its regular state.
